我试图从rpm包安装pyatspi,并遇到了这个错误:
[root@dhcp-128-69 Downloads]# rpm -i pyatspi-2.2.1-1.fc16.noarch.rpm
warning: pyatspi-2.2.1-1.fc16.noarch.rpm: Header V3 RSA/SHA256 Signature, key ID a82ba4b7: NOKEY
error: Failed dependencies:
python(abi) = 2.7 is needed by pyatspi-2.2.1-1.fc16.noarch
但我已经安装了python2.7.10并将其链接到命令" python":
[root@dhcp-128-69 Downloads]# /usr/bin/python -V
Python 2.6.6
[root@dhcp-128-69 Downloads]# python -V
Python 2.7.10
运行rpm时会出现什么情况?
为什么它没有指向python2.7?
答案 0 :(得分:0)
rpm仅检查rpmdb的依赖项。由于你的rpmdb声称拥有2.6,所以它无法满足2.7依赖性。请改用pip来安装模块。